Sony Pictures Caves to More Hacker Demands Wipes ‘Interview’ From Social Media

Sony quietly gave in to another hacker demand by wiping almost all traces of “The Interview” from its social media pages. Hackers threatened top level Sony execs Friday saying, “We want everything related to the movie, including its trailers, as well as its full version down from any website hosting them immediately.”  The movie’s Twitter page no longer has any tweets, the Facebook page has been deleted and all “Interview” footage has been wiped from its YouTube page. Sir Elton John and David Furnish Got Married

Elton John and his longtime partner David Furnish are finally going all the way.  That’s right, they got  married this weekend.  They’ve had a civil partnership since 2005, but gay marriage just became legal in Britain in March, so now they’re making it happen. Elton and David have been together since 1993, and they have two sons:  Zachary, who’ll be four on Christmas Day, and Elijah, who’ll be two next month. Get the full story here.

Michael Phelps pleads guilty to DUI

Olympic gold medal swimmer Michael Phelps avoided jail time on Friday when a judge placed him on probation for pleading guilty to a drunken driving charge for the second time in 10 years.  “You don’t need a lecture from the court,” Baltimore District Judge Nathan Braverman told Phelps. “If you haven’t gotten the message by now, or forget the message, the only option is jail.” Probation allows the most decorated Olympian ever to focus on training for the 2016 Games in Rio De Janeiro, which would be his fifth. Hackers Threaten to Release Iggy Azalea’s Alleged Sex Tape If She Doesn’t Apologize to Azealia Banks

A mysterious Twitter handle named @TheAnonMessage has threatened to release still images from an alleged sex tape involving Iggy Azalea unless she publicly apologizes toAzealia Banks and the protesters of the #BlackLivesMatter movement. “MESSAGE: @IGGYAZALEA, you have exactly 48 hours from now to release a statement apologizing to @AzealiaBanks and the protesters in NYC…” one of the tweets captured byVulture read. “You are guilty of misappropriating black culture, insulting peaceful protesters, and making light of Eric Garner’s death. @IGGYAZALEA” The account has since been suspended by Twitter. David Schwimmer Will Play Robert Kardashian In O.J. Simpson Miniseries

David Schwimmer is the latest actor to join “The People v. O.J. Simpson,” the first season of the upcoming series that will follow Simpson’s 1995 murder trial. The “Friends” alum will portray Robert Kardashian, Simpson’s friend and lawyer during the case. The 10-episode first season will star Cuba Gooding Jr. as the former football player and Sarah Paulson as head prosecutor Marcia Clark. Get the full story here.
